Can Radeon RX 7900 XTX run Rogue Shift?

Great

The Radeon RX 7900 XTX handles Rogue Shift well at 1080p, delivering approximately 497 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 373 FPS.

Rogue ShiftRadeon RX 7900 XTX FPS Data

Quality1080p1440p4K
Low777 fps583 fps311 fps
Medium622 fps466 fps249 fps
High497 fps373 fps199 fps
Ultra404 fps303 fps162 fps

Estimated FPS · actual performance may vary based on drivers and settings

Minimum System Requirements

CPU
Intel Core-i5 3.0GHz
GPU
N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1050 4GB or equivalent
RAM
8 GB

About

Rogue Shift, released in 2023, is an action-adventure indie RPG that immerses players in a high-intensity rogue-lite experience. Set on a ruthless planet, the game challenges your survival skills, combining fast-paced gameplay with intriguing RPG elements. Its unique setting and engaging mechanics make it a standout title in the indie gaming scene, drawing players looking for an adrenaline rush.

In terms of PC performance, Rogue Shift is quite accessible. With a minimum GPU requirement of an entry-level model scoring around 5046, even budget-friendly systems can run the game smoothly. Players looking to achieve decent FPS at higher graphics settings should consider mid-range GPUs, such as the GTX 1650 or RX 580, which will enhance the overall gaming experience while maintaining solid benchmarks.
